Owameri small scale irrigation system, commissioned yesterday in the Northern district of Alebtong is expected to benefit 400 framers in Lango, Acholi, West Nile and Upper Central sub regions of Northern Uganda.
The focus, according to Minister of Water and Environment officials, is on production of high value crops to eradicate poverty in the region.
The production of crops such as water melons, onions, cabbages, tomatoes, carrots and green paper is expected to grow.
Inspecting the project before commissioning, the Assistant Commissioner, Water for Production, Eng. John Twinomujuni commended the farmers’ efforts and hard work, advising them to continue investing in the system for sustainability.
